Latest on Daikatana
by Steve Gibson, Feb 10, 2000 1:57pm PSTWell I guess it's about time we had a bit more of an update on the happenings at Ion Storm's Daikatana. As a number of people have noted there are advertisements and stands showing up at computer stores for Daikatana which usually signals an immanent release. The word on the street is they arent ready for release just yet though. Not good for Eidos as was mentioned about a week ago they arent doing so hot lately. A few people who are close to Ion have sent in word that Ion is considering not having multiplayer in the initial release and following-up with a patch. It seems doubtful to me but I'm sure we'll see soon enough. Also, looks like the KillCreek playboy stuff is delayed some more. Last I heard it's gonna be in the May issue now. update by Maarten: There's a new movie on Incitegames. It has appeared on their magazine CD before, features ingame footage and a few words from Romero and KillCreek, and is a 43mb download. update by Steve: As expected, the multiplayer rumors are false. both Romero and KillCreek made comments stating that it's 'ludicrous'.
